“waiting for the robert e lee” is a 1912 composition by Lewis F. Muir and L. Wolfe Gilbert that became a popular jazz and ragtime standard. It was recorded by artists including Bessie Smith and early jazz orchestras. The melody is playful and syncopated, typical of early jazz and ragtime influences, and allows performers to showcase both technical skill and swing feel.
